The medical processing seals market size was valued at US$ 2.14 Billion in 2025 and is projected to reach US$ 3.61 Billion by 2034, registering a CAGR of 5.96% during 2026–2034. The market is supported by rising demand for high-performance sealing solutions across diagnostic systems, drug delivery devices, surgical instruments, and sterilization-sensitive healthcare equipment. Material innovation, regulatory compliance requirements, and increasing medical device production continue to shape long-term industry expansion.

Across North America, manufacturers are investing in advanced elastomer and fluoropolymer technologies to improve device reliability and patient safety. The medical processing seals market size in the region is supported by expanding minimally invasive procedures, growing domestic medical manufacturing, and stricter quality standards established by regulatory authorities. Regional demand is expected to advance at a CAGR range of 5.2%–6.0% through 2034.

The evolving needs of healthcare manufacturing have led to changes in the nature of materials used for seals. There is now a greater demand for high purity silicone, engineered PTFE, and metal sealing solutions that retain their integrity even during multiple sterilization cycles. The growing need for wearable healthcare technologies, robotic surgical equipment, and diagnostic devices has prompted manufacturers to develop materials with greater dimensional stability, contamination resistance, and durability, leading to further strengthening of the market in the medical components industry.

The future growth of the market is going to be driven by infrastructure development in healthcare manufacturing in the Asia Pacific region, Eastern Europe, and some Middle Eastern countries. With regulatory harmonization efforts underway, localized manufacturing of medical devices, and greater focus on infection control, more advanced seals are being adopted by the manufacturers.

Medical Processing Seals Market Analysis

The development in the market for seals used in the medical sector depends on the increasing production of medical devices and equipment that require contamination control, fluid management, and pressure maintenance. These seals have a vital part in infusion systems, respiratory devices, imaging equipment, diagnostic analyzers, and surgical tools. The increasing trend of minimally invasive surgery and home care products is driving the need for small, robust, and chemical-resistant seals.

Value Chain includes raw material suppliers, compound formulators, precision parts manufacturer, medical device manufacturers, and healthcare service provider. Supply factors are regulated by regulatory compliance issues, traceability of material, and clean room manufacturing. Seal manufacturers now give more emphasis to biocompatibility and sterilization compatibility due to customer demands.

The level of competition stays intense due to differentiation based on engineering, customization and regulatory services. According to medical processing seals market report, reliable products, validations and rapid prototyping are increasingly significant factors of procurement. Collaborations of seal producers and device designers facilitate faster market entry of the latter.

Freudenberg SE, Parker-Hannifin Corporation, Trelleborg AB, Minnesota Rubber and Plastics, and Bal Seal Engineering, Inc., are the leading companies developing medical products. Automation, clean rooms and development of materials improve competitive position in the market. Mergers and collaborative engineering projects are typical acquisition strategies in this market niche.

Segmentation Analysis

Material

The Material segment plays a critical role in determining performance, biocompatibility, chemical resistance, and sterilization compatibility. The segment is projected to grow at a CAGR of 5.9%–6.6% during 2026–2034. The medical processing seals market scope continues expanding as manufacturers seek advanced materials capable of meeting increasingly stringent healthcare requirements while maintaining long-term operational reliability.

  • Silicone – Widely utilized due to flexibility, biocompatibility, and temperature resistance. Strong adoption across respiratory devices, drug delivery systems, and diagnostic equipment supports its strategic importance within healthcare manufacturing.
  • Metal – Preferred for applications requiring structural integrity, pressure resistance, and durability. Demand remains concentrated in specialized equipment where dimensional stability and long service life are critical performance requirements.
  • PTFE – Increasingly adopted because of exceptional chemical resistance and sterilization compatibility. The material is gaining traction in advanced medical systems requiring low friction, purity, and contamination control.

Type

The Type segment is expected to register a CAGR of 5.7%–6.3% between 2026 and 2034. Product selection depends on operating environment, pressure requirements, and equipment design specifications. Manufacturers continue developing precision-engineered configurations that enhance device performance while supporting regulatory compliance and manufacturing efficiency.

  • O-Rings – Represent a core sealing solution across medical devices due to design simplicity, cost efficiency, and versatility. Adoption remains broad across fluid handling, diagnostic, and monitoring applications.
  • Gaskets – Essential for maintaining sealing integrity between component interfaces. Demand is supported by increasing equipment complexity and stricter performance requirements in healthcare environments.
  • Lip Seals – Used where rotational or dynamic motion requires effective contamination prevention. Growing utilization in pumps and specialized medical equipment supports continued market relevance.

Application

The Application segment is anticipated to grow at a CAGR of 5.8%–6.4% through 2034. Increasing healthcare equipment deployment, aging populations, and technological innovation continue supporting demand. Application-specific engineering requirements are encouraging manufacturers to deliver customized sealing solutions tailored to unique performance conditions.

  • Medical Devices – Largest application category supported by extensive use in diagnostics, therapeutic systems, monitoring equipment, and wearable healthcare technologies. Reliability and biocompatibility remain critical purchasing considerations.
  • Medical Equipments – Demand is driven by imaging systems, laboratory instruments, sterilization equipment, and surgical technologies. Performance consistency and durability remain key evaluation criteria among equipment manufacturers.

Medical Processing Seals Market Growth Drivers and Impact Analysis

Expansion of Global Medical Device Manufacturing

Further growth in the output of medical diagnostics tools, infusions, respiratory devices, and patient monitoring systems is sustaining demand for highly sophisticated sealants. The need for sealants that can operate efficiently in scenarios of sterilization, pressure changes, and chemical reactions is becoming more prominent in medical device companies. Modernization projects in health care sectors in developed and developing countries are generating further demand for components that improve the safety of patients and extend the lifespan of medical equipment. With increasing production volumes, component providers are also making investments in automation, validation, and cleanroom manufacturing processes.

Rising Regulatory Focus on Safety and Reliability

Healthcare regulators are still stressing product reliability, contamination protection, and material traceability within the entire process of medical manufacturing value chain. These compliance requirements make manufacturers move towards the use of high-grade sealing materials which are characterized by biocompatibility and durability. Validation tests and documentation procedures are being actively performed by manufacturers to comply with the demands of customers and regulators. Widespread usage of new diagnostics and treatment equipment imposes additional performance demands on sealing elements. Standardization of regulatory policies across several regions contributes to the wider implementation of internationally recognized quality standards, opening up opportunities for manufacturers of highly sophisticated products.

Growth in Minimally Invasive and Home Healthcare Technologies

The trend towards minimally invasive techniques and the move towards patient care from home is bringing about some need for medical systems that are small, light, and robust. These medical systems depend on sealants for fluid management and containment of contamination. The rising use of portable diagnostic devices, wearable technology, and telehealth solutions has increased the market size of seals used. Manufacturers are catering to this through innovations in material sciences and miniaturizing components to meet the requirements of the emerging medical system platforms. The increasing digitalization of healthcare services will drive the demand throughout the forecast period.
